What affects the price

When you’re budgeting for new sliding doors, a few things change the bottom line. The biggest factor is the size of the opening and the material you choose—like vinyl, aluminum, or wood. If the existing frame needs structural repair or the wall requires reframing, that adds time and labor. High-performance glass, custom finishes, and upgraded hardware also shift the total.
